Hi,

I encountered the following problem when I try to use web form or send data using Internet Explorer. May be due to my browser has been corrupted by any virus or something else. But my question is how can the problem be solved? My internet experience is very bad right this time.

 

Windows Internet Explorer

An error has occurred in this dialog.

Error: 54

Unspecified error.

Run a disk check on your hard drive to see if there is an error in its file structures:

  1. Right click on drive C and then select Properties.
  2. Click Tools tab.
  3. Click Check Now button.
  4. Check Automatically fix file system errors and then click Start. Wait for the disk check to finish.

If all seems well after disk checking update your antivirus then run a full-system scan on your computer. If nothing is found on the virus scan, install other internet browser like Mozilla Firefox 7.0.1, the latest version which can be downloaded.

This problem is related to add-on errors on your Internet Explorer.

Solution 1: Try running you Internet Explorer with no add-ons running. To open this you need to click Start, All Programs, then go to Accessories, System Tools. You will see it there, and it says Internet Explorer (No add-ons). Test the same website that the error occurred.

Solution 2: Change your web browser or upgrade your Internet Explorer. You can try using Mozilla Firefox, Google Chrome or Safari. These are the most commonly used web browser of today. Try Using one of those and then run the same website.

Solution 3: You can also try updating your Java because it might be java related error.
